Object

The Help Wanted sign is a sign that sometimes appears in the window or on the door of the Krusty Krab in certain episodes. It first appears in the episode "Help Wanted."

Description[]

It is a white rectangular sign with the words "help wanted" written in red lettering and all capitals, usually seen when someone gets fired or if the Krusty Krab needs extra employment.

Role in series[]

"Help Wanted"/My Happy Book: SpongeBob's 10 Happiest Moments[]

The Help Wanted sign is on the Krusty Krab window. SpongeBob notes that the sign is there and Squidward panics when he realizes SpongeBob has come to apply for a job.

"Hooky"[]

When Mr. Krabs is acting as if SpongeBob is going to die due to the hook "taking him away," he puts up the Help Wanted sign on the Krusty Krab.

"Dying for Pie"[]

After learning that SpongeBob has eaten the exploding pie, Squidward takes him out to do all the things he wanted to do before he dies. As they leave the Krusty Krab, Mr. Krabs can be seen putting the sign on the window. SpongeBob wrongly assumes that Squidward is going to be fired.

"Welcome to the Chum Bucket"[]

The sign appears near the end of the episode, because Mr. Krabs had put up the sign when SpongeBob had to work at the Chum Bucket and had not yet had time to take it down.

"Sailor Mouth"[]

The sign's appearance in this episode is an error, as the sign is briefly seen, but no one was fired.

"Squid on Strike"[]

Mr. Krabs is seen blowing dust off the sign shortly after firing SpongeBob and Squidward.

"As Seen on TV"[]

The sign briefly appears on the windows of both Krusty Krabs. It can also been seen on the window of the Krusty Krab during the Krusty Krab commercial.

"Krab Borg"[]

The sign appears on the Krusty Krab window when the Krusty Krab first appears in the middle of the episode.
